Founding Engineer

Summary

Build core infrastructure for a graph-native AI context platform, owning query engines, storage layers, and distributed systems in Rust or Go.

About the Role

A well-funded, early-stage infrastructure company is hiring 2–3 Founding Engineers to work on the core of a graph-native context and memory platform purpose-built for modern AI workloads. This is not a feature factory role — you will own significant pieces of the platform, including the query engine, storage layer, and graph internals, and make architecture decisions that will shape the product for years to come.

You'll work directly alongside the founding team, with your name on design docs and pull requests in the same week. The team is small, high-conviction, and moves fast — every engineer has direct influence on architecture, roadmap, and culture.

The platform addresses a critical gap in AI infrastructure: giving AI agents persistent, structured, and temporally aware context through a GraphDB built on object storage, with semantic search, git-style temporal versioning, and entity resolution. The company has raised a Seed/Series A round from prominent investors and researchers in the AI space.
